Series

Norwegian School Election Studies

Since 1989 national school elections have been organized in connection with municipal/county council and parliamentary elections in Norway. NSD – Norwegian Centre for Research Data has served as a national organizer and coordinator, while the elections until 2003 were funded by Kirke-, utdannings- og forskningsdepartementet (KUF). Since 2005, Utdanningsdirektoratet has financed the school elections, and has overall responsibility for the project. For more information about school elections, see: www.samfunnsveven.no

Abstract

"School Election 1995, National Study" is a national poll (telephone interview) conducted by Norsk Gallup Institutt AS on behalf of NSD – Norwegian Centre for Research Data (now Sikt - Norwegian Agency for Shared Services in Education and Research). The questions that are included in the poll are essentially the same as those offered to pupils in high school in the 1995 school election poll.
